Triglycerides

These are fat particles traveling in the bloodstream.

Normal concentration is less than 150 mg/dl.

A high triglyceride level has a questionable causal association with cardiac mortality but seems to be associated with increased high low-density lipoprotein levels of dense, small, easily oxidized particles, which are associated with increased atherosclerotic cardiovascular disease (ASCVD).

Clients’ triglyceride levels dropped to what is considered a safe zone of 69 in contrast to the 10-percent-fat vegan research of Esselstyne, which was a high of 144.

My clients routinely see their triglycerides going to normal after one month on moderate-low carbohydrate live foods.

C-Reactive Protein (CRP)

CRP is a proinflammatory cytokine that is a cardiovascular disease risk factor. The CRP reading indicates the degree of inflammation; it is determined by measuring the amount of a specific protein in the blood. Recent research suggests that patients with elevated levels of CRP are at increased risk for diabetes,

hypertension, and cardiovascular disease.

A study of more than 700 nurses showed that those in the highest quartile of trans-fat consumption had blood levels of CRP that were 73 percent higher than those in the lowest quartile.

As the reader now knows, inflammation is the fourth stage of disease, so one can use this test to first determine how far along someone is in the disease process and, even more important, to mark one’s progression back through the seven stages to a healthy physiology. Inflammation contributes to complications that are further along than the fourth stage of disease, such as ulceration (Stage 5), so seeing this marker come down is a significant sign of improvement in health. I measured an average CRP decrease of 70 percent, after one month on the program.

Client 2

This 25-year-old male had a medical history of hospital-diagnosed Type-1 diabetes for more than 1.5 years. His medications included Lantis (15, 20 units daily) and Glucophage (500 mg twice a day).

FIGURE 2. FBS for client 2

After just four days on the program, client 2 was off his insulin completely, with an FBS of 88.

By two weeks, his FBS was consistently below 73 and remained there since.

His fructosamine dropped from 480 to 340, within normal range, in three weeks.

His glycosylated hemoglobin HgbA1c has returned to 6.0 from 11.8.

Total cholesterol went from 216 to 150 and LDL cholesterol from 142 to 88.

His triglyceride level fell from 65 to 53.

Weight loss was not a serious need for this client, who was close to his optimal weight; he lost six pounds in 20 days and then gained back three pounds.

To resolve the question of whether this patient was really Type-1, the patient (on his own) went to his local MD for further tests to determine whether he was Type-1 or Type-2.

His beta cell antibody titers were significantly high at 8.9 (normal is 0, 1.5), strongly suggesting that he is indeed a Type-1 diabetic.

His clinical history, which was one of rapid and fulminating onset of diabetes, causing him to be hospitalized with a blood sugar of 1,200, is consistent with a medical history of Type-1 diabetes, as contrasted with Type-2, which is characterized by a slow onset of symptoms.

It is interesting, and perhaps historic in the field of diabetes research, to note that in a one-year follow-up, his serum C-peptide, which is associated with a precursor protein to insulin, was originally less than 0.5 and is now 0.7.

This suggests that the program is actually beginning to rebuild or reactivate the beta cells of his pancreas to produce insulin.

Wheat

Wheat, according to Ayurvedic principles, is kaphagenic (heavy and sweet) and therefore not recommended for diabetics. We do not include wheat, specifically white bread, also due to its alloxan content. Alloxan is the chemical that makes white flour look clean, white, and “beautiful.” A remarkable discovery that a single injection of alloxan can produce diabetes mellitus in laboratory animals was made in 1942, in Glasgow, by John Shaw Dunn and Norman McLetchie.

Scientists and FDA officials have known about this connection for years.

Alloxan causes diabetes by creating free radical damage to the DNA in the beta cells of the pancreas.

The Textbook of Natural Medicine calls alloxan a “potent beta cell toxin.” It is unfortunate that the FDA still allows companies to use it to process foods we eat.

Research also shows that we are able to reverse the effects of alloxan with vitamin E.

According to Dr.

Gary Null’s Clinicians’ Handbook of Natural Healing , vitamin E effectively protected lab rats from the harmful effects of administered alloxan.
